Psalms Chapter 1 starts with “Blessed is the man” and continues to say in verse three “he is like a tree planted by streams of water.”
Notice how it says a tree and not trees. So this is one singular tree. One life. One person. One tree.
Then it goes on to say planted by multiple streams. Meaning many streams.
So one tree is supplied by many streams. That is you. You are that one tree and you are supplied by God’s goodness by many streams. One lifetime’s worth of wants and needs are fulfilled by many streams!
One you. Many streams, so all the food, friends, holidays, businesses, clothes, overpriced coffees you will ever need.
The verse goes onto say “whose leaf does not wither”. Trees need their leaves to receive sunlight and to turn the sunlight it into enegry to bring forth fruit.
I think of those leaves as our arms, we have to stretch our arms out towards the supply (God) so we can receive from Him, and as a result, have fruit in our life.
Remember this: God’s supply is always greater than our need.
